Practice for a job interview with me

"How do I come across in that conversation?"

​

​Do you have an important job interview soon? And would you like to get the most out of your words? Practice with me!

​

​Have you prepared your answers, but do want to find out if you can communicate them smoothly in a conversation?

​

Would you like to briefly introduce yourself with a sparkling pitch that really suits you?

​

​In this coaching session you will practice your interview with me through role play for a realistic duration of a typical job interview. So you are just yourself and I’ll play the part of your interviewer, asking you questions from their perspective.

​

After the exercise we’ll talk about how we each experienced it. You will receive positive and constructive feedback and, if you wish, also fun, practical exercises tailored to your needs.

Practice challenging conversations with me

"How do I share what I have to say in a challenging conversation?"

​

​​Do you want to start a difficult  conversation with someone?

​

Do you find this a challenge? And are you a little worried about whether you can stay true to yourself and clearly communicate what you want to say? Practice with me!

​

​Do you know roughly what you want to say? Do you want to practice how to put it into words? How will you handle it if someone reacts in a different way than you expected?

​

In this coaching session you will practice your conversation with me through a simulated situation. So you are and remain yourself and I’ll play the role of your conversation partner, and will respond from their perspective.

 

If desired, I can also give you a variety of reactions, so that you can safely practice how you can respond.

 

After the simulation we talk about how we each experienced it. You will receive positive and constructive feedback and, if you wish, also fun, practical exercises tailored to your needs.

​

We’ll go step by step. This way you get more tools and confidence in a safe setting to express yourself in a conversation.
